A rural retreat not far from Tampa

Shady Hills is a community in the far north section of Pasco County that, while not too far from Tampa—about 40 miles north of the bustling metropolis—feels like a world away. Narrow residential streets are lined with tall, mature trees and neighbors are spread out in houses on sprawling lots. The lone major thoroughfare, Suncoast Parkway, is lined with more trees and expansive farmland. It’s hard to believe it’s home to about 12,000 residents and not 1,200. "This is a peaceful area to live, and everybody has at least an acre or more. The more land you have, the more secluded you feel," says Tina Brooks, a long-time resident and co-owner of Green Acres Blueberry Farm, which has been serving the area for nearly 20 years. However, while Shady Hills might seem isolated, it’s not. Just outside the community are highways that lead to the rest of Central Florida, and it’s just south of suburban Spring Hill, which offers many amenities.

Homes sit on lots spanning an acre or more

Shady Hills offers ranch-style homes built between the 1950s and 1970s, new traditional styles built after 2000, and sprawling custom estates. Some homes are zoned as agricultural residences for those looking to raise animals. Lawns often span an acre or more. Low fences and tall, mature trees surround houses. The median home price is about $370,000, slightly higher than nearby Spring Hill but less expensive than the state’s. Most of the community is residential. However, the southern section contains industrial properties, including a waste management facility and a power station.

Residents enjoy parks and the nearby Gulf Coast Homing Club

Crews Lake Wilderness Park is a prime space for locals looking to hike trails, board a scale train or enjoy a weekend camping. Its lake invites boaters and anglers to explore the marshes, which are often decorated with water lilies and other native greenery. Elsie Logan Memorial Park features a community garden and a playground. The community’s proximity to the Gulf Coast Homing Club in Spring Hill is a draw for pigeon racing fans. The club has about 300 members and hosts regular competitions.

Children attend Pasco County Schools or nearby private schools

Pasco County Schools serves the community. The district rates a B-plus on Niche and offers school choice. Bishop McLaughlin Catholic High School is the closest private school and rates an A on Niche. West Hernando Christian School is also nearby, rates a B-minus and serves kindergarten through 12th grade.

Shopping and dining in Spring Hill, blueberry picking and wine tasting in the community

Shady Hills is primarily residential, and there is little retail directly within the community, so residents head into Spring Hill for shopping and dining and the closest medical center, Tampa General Hospital Spring Hill. Within the community, Green Acres Blueberry Farm offers blueberry, strawberry and seasonal vegetable picking. Strong Tower Vineyard & Winery offers a tasting room and events like yoga and salsa dancing. “We now have more events that focus on the community. And the area is also growing and getting busier too," says Brooks.

Suncoast Parkway connects to Tampa and Tampa International Airport

Florida Route 589, also known as Suncoast Parkway, runs through the community's east side and connects to Tampa, about 40 miles away. Tampa International Airport is about 36 miles away.
